Transaction 32c15aafb8a44e2e2056ec84e2b1fecdc6512c36b9fe616f442d41f5cbb9273a

23 Input
1 Outputs
  • 32c15aafb8a44e2e2056ec84e2b1fecdc6512c36b9fe616f442d41f5cbb9273a:0
  • value  1889882
    address  3Fv4eDeoxHotp3E3Nr2SrmfmRWafmBkgLW